Types of Baby Stair Gates
Choosing the right stair gate involves understanding the different types available. Here are some popular options:
- Pressure-mounted gates: These gates do not require any drilling and are easy to install, making them ideal for temporary use.
- Hardware-mounted gates: These gates are more secure and are often used at the top of stairs, as they are fixed to the wall.
- Retractable gates: These gates can be pulled across the opening when needed and retracted when not in use, offering flexibility and convenience.
Key Features to Consider
When searching for the best baby stair gate, consider these essential features:
- Height: Ensure the gate is tall enough to prevent your child from climbing over.
- Material: Look for durable materials like wood or metal that can withstand daily use.
- Ease of Use: Opt for a gate that can be opened and closed with one hand for convenience.
- Safety Standards: Check for compliance with safety regulations to ensure your gate is safe for your child.

Frequently Asked Questions About Best Baby Stair Gate
What is the best height for a baby stair gate?
The ideal height for a baby stair gate is typically around 75cm (30 inches) or higher to prevent toddlers from climbing over.
Can I use a pressure-mounted gate at the top of the stairs?
It is not recommended to use pressure-mounted gates at the top of stairs. A hardware-mounted gate provides more security and stability in these areas.
How do I know if a stair gate meets safety standards?
Look for certifications or labels indicating compliance with safety regulations, such as BS EN 1930:2011 in the UK.
Are there stair gates that fit unusual spaces?
Yes, there are adjustable and extendable stair gates designed to fit various widths and unique spaces. Be sure to measure your area before purchase.
